About Gunnar Hellekson

Gunnar HelleksonI’m the Chief Technology Strategist for Red Hat’s US Public Sector group, where I work with systems integrators and government agencies to encourage the use of open source software in government. I’m a Red Hat Certified Engineer, and the author of all kinds of whitepapers and lengthy emails like “New Approaches to Multilevel Security with Red Hat Enterprise Linux.” You can see a fat version of me talking about some of this on our Open Source in Government site. Recently, I helped found Open Source for America and was named one of Federal Computer Week’s Fed 100 for 2010.

Prior to joining Red Hat, I worked as a developer, systems administrator, and IT director for a series of internet businesses. I’ve also been a business and IT consultant to not-for-profit organizations in New York City. During that time, I spearheaded the reform of safety regulations for New York State’s electrical utilities following the tragic death of Jodie Lane.

When I’m not spreading the Good News about open source, I’m wishing I had a dog.
